Definition of milk tea noun from the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ary

milk tea

noun
 
/ˌmɪlk ˈtiː/
 
/ˌmɪlk ˈtiː/
[uncountable] (South-East Asian English)
jump to other results
  1. strong black tea with condensed milk or evaporated milk
    • I had a cup of milk tea with my sandwich.
    Topics Drinksc1
  2. (also bubble tea)
    a drink made from cold tea mixed with milk, flavourings, etc., which also contains small sweet balls that look like bubbles and are made from tapioca
    • They stopped on their way home to drink some milk tea.
